С ними связана , по легенде- такая романтическая история: будущий король Англии George IV получил в подарок от возлюбленной миниатюру с изображением только ее глаз, чтобы посторонние не могли узнать персонажа и влюблюбленные могли бы сохранить в тайне свои отношения. Такие памятные миниатюры вошли в моду и стали очень популярны в 1790- 1820 годах, да и позже их делали везде- в Англии, Франции,России. Сохранились броши, заколки, медальоны, шкатулочки, браслеты, где изображены только глаза, часто с ними соседствует локон или плетенка из волос любимого человека,...
